\subsection{Plotting multilines}

There is a new macro called \Lcs{psLine} (uppercase L!) which can have
only one or two pairs of coordinates. Remember that \Lcs{psline} can have more.
With \Lcs{psLine} and an defined arrow you'll get nothing for something
like \verb|\psLine{->}{1,1)(1,1)|, whereas \Lcs{psline} will output the arrowtip!
This behaviour of \Lcs{psLine} maybe helpful for animations where a speedvector
or a vector
is  shown with its components and one do not really knows the coordinates.

\begin{BDef}
\Lcs{psLine}\OptArgs\OptArg{\Largr{$x_0,y_0$}}\Largr{$x_1,y_1$}\\
\Lcs{psLineSegments}\OptArgs\Largr{$x_0,y_0$}\Largr{$x_1,y_1$}\ldots\Largr{$x_{n-1},y_{n-1}$}\Largr{$x_n,y_n$}
\end{BDef}

If $P_0$ is missing for \Lcs{psLine} then $(0,0)$ as first point is assumed. \Lcs{psLineSegments} expects always
pairwise coordinates.

\subsection{Error message}

Using PSTricks with \Lprog{pdflatex} will work only when using package
\LPack{auto-pst-pdf} and running the \TeX-file with

\begin{verbatim}
pdflatex -shell-escape <file>
\end{verbatim}

otherwise you'll get an error message which was misleading in the past:

\begin{verbatim}
[...]
! Undefined control sequence.
<recently read> \c@lor@to@ps 
\end{verbatim}

This changes now to 


\begin{verbatim}
[...]
! Undefined control sequence.
\c@lor@to@ps ->\PSTricks 
                         _Not_Configured_For_This_Format
\end{verbatim}


\subsection{Optional argument \texttt{xetex}}
The output driver \Lprog{xdvipdfmx} for using \XeTeX\  or  \XeLaTeX\ is not fully
compatible to \Lprog{dvips}. Especially some node operations will not work. If the
\LaTeX\  package detects a programm run with \XeLaTeX\ it automatically loads the file
\Lfile{pstricks-xetex.def} which defines some macros with a new name to keep the existing
ones. By now there is only
\Lcs{NCput}, which is the same as \Lcs{ncput}, but works with \XeLaTeX.

If someone wants to use these macros though he/she runs not \XeLaTeX\ then these macros are
available too by using the optional argument \Loption{xetex}:

\begin{verbatim}
\usepackage[xetex]{pstricks}
\end{verbatim}
